Highlights

On average, there are 299 sunny days per year in Peoria. Olympia averages 136 sunny days per year. The US average is 205 sunny days.

Peoria, Arizona gets 9.5 inches of rain, on average, per year. Olympia, Washington gets 52.7 inches of rain, on average, per year. The US average is 38.1 inches of rain per year.

Peoria averages 0.1 inches of snow per year. Olympia averages 6 inches of snow per year. The US average is 27.8 inches of snow per year.

August is the hottest month for Olympia with an average high temperature of 78.0°, which ranks it as about average compared to other places in Washington. In Olympia, there are 4 comfortable months with high temperatures in the range of 70-85°. The most pleasant months of the year for Olympia are August, July and September.

July is the hottest month for Peoria with an average high temperature of 105.3°, which ranks it as warmer than most places in Arizona. In Peoria, there are 4 comfortable months with high temperatures in the range of 70-85°. The most pleasant months of the year for Peoria are March, November and April.
December has the coldest nighttime temperatures for Olympia with an average of 32.9°. This is about average compared to other places in Washington.

December has the coldest nighttime temperatures for Peoria with an average of 41.9°. This is one of the warmest places in Arizona.

In Olympia, there are 5.7 days annually when the high temperature is over 90°, which is about average compared to other places in Washington.

In Peoria, there are 164.7 days annually when the high temperature is over 90°, which is hotter than most places in Arizona.

In Olympia, there are 61.6 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below freezing, which is about average compared to other places in Washington.

In Peoria, there are 2.5 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below freezing, which is one of the warmest places in Arizona.

In Olympia, there are 0.0 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below zero°, which is about average compared to other places in Washington.

In Peoria, there are 0.0 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below zero°, which is about average compared to other places in Arizona.

November is the wettest month in Olympia with 9.0 inches of rain, and the driest month is July with 0.8 inches. The wettest season is Spring with 41% of yearly precipitation and 7% occurs in Autumn, which is the driest season. The annual rainfall of 52.7 inches in Olympia means that it is wetter than most places in Washington.


February is the wettest month in Peoria with 1.3 inches of rain, and the driest month is May with 0.1 inches. The wettest season is Spring with 37% of yearly precipitation and 16% occurs in Summer, which is the driest season. The annual rainfall of 9.5 inches in Peoria means that it is drier than most places in Arizona.

November is the rainiest month in Olympia with 21.0 days of rain, and July is the driest month with only 4.8 rainy days. There are 167.2 rainy days annually in Olympia, which is rainier than most places in Washington. The rainiest season is Spring when it rains 34% of the time and the driest is Autumn with only a 11% chance of a rainy day.

February is the rainiest month in Peoria with 3.9 days of rain, and June is the driest month with only 0.4 rainy days. There are 31.9 rainy days annually in Peoria, which is less rainy than most places in Arizona. The rainiest season is Spring when it rains 36% of the time and the driest is Summer with only a 19% chance of a rainy day.

An annual snowfall of 6.0 inches in Olympia means that it is about average compared to other places in Washington.

An annual snowfall of 0.1 inches in Peoria means that it is less snowy than most places in Arizona.
February is the snowiest month in Olympia with 2.3 inches of snow, and 4 months of the year have significant snowfall.

December is the snowiest month in Peoria with 0.0 inches of snow, and no months of the year have significant snowfall.

DID YOU KNOW?

Many people confuse Weather and Climate, but they are different. Weather refers to the conditions of the atmosphere over a short period of time, while Climate refers to the conditions of the atmosphere over a long period of time.

Weather, more specifically, refers to how the atmosphere behaves and its effects on life and human activities. Most people think of Weather in terms of what can be observed: temperature, humidity, precipitation, and cloudy/sunny conditions. Weather conditions constantly change on a minute-to-minute basis.

Climate is a record of the average weather conditions for a given place over a long period of time, often referred to as Climate Normals. A 30-year period of record is a common requirement to be considered a Climate Normal.
